Standout Features and Core Specifications
Feature | Details |
---|---|
Brand / Model | SereneLife / PUCRC455 |
Mapping & Navigation | Gyroscope mapping, S-path navigation, Anti-fall sensors |
Suction Power | 1100Pa (est.) |
Battery Life | Up to 110 minutes, 2500mAh Li-ion battery |
Control Options | App (iOS/Android), Alexa, Google Assistant, remote control |
Dustbin Capacity | 0.6 Liters |
Height / Size | Ultra-thin (2.9″) — fits under furniture |
Noise Level | Less than 65dB (ultra quiet) |
Compatibility | Amazon Echo, Google Home, iOS/Android app support |
Included Accessories | Charging dock, remote, cleaning brush, two sweep brushes & filters, batteries |

Mapping & Navigation Performance
A key differentiator for the PUCRC455 is its internal gyroscope for mapping and S-path routing. The robot systematically cleans open areas by mimicking traditional vacuum lines. Users report fewer missed spots and more predictable coverage than random-navigation robots.
The ultra-thin profile (2.9″) means the vacuum accesses tight spaces under couches, beds, and cabinets that bulkier models can’t. Anti-fall sensors help prevent tumbles down stairs or ledges, boosting peace of mind for multi-level homes.
Suction, Filtration, and Dustbin Evaluated
With a 1100Pa suction motor and dual-sweep side brushes, the SereneLife vacuum targets dust, crumbs, and pet hair on both hard floors and low-pile carpets. Users praise its ability to pick up visible dirt and dander, though carpet deep cleaning is not its specialty.
The HEPA-style cartridge filter system traps fine particles, helping maintain air quality for allergic households. The 0.6-liter dustbin is above average for the price tier, letting the robot handle several sessions before it needs emptying.
Battery Life, Charging, and Runtime
Battery performance is rated for up to 110 minutes per charge. Many users confirm real-world runtimes of 80–100 minutes on mixed surfaces, more than adequate for the intended 160 sq. meter (est. 1700 sq. ft.) coverage per cycle.
Automated docking and recharging are reliable when the robot starts near its home base, but some customers find occasional difficulties in dock-finding if the robot is separated by obstacles or multiple rooms.
Smart Controls: App, Voice, and Remote Functions
The PUCRC455 stands out for its multi-platform control: WiFi app (iOS/Android), Alexa and Google Assistant compatibility, plus a bundled physical remote. The Smart Life app enables:
- Scheduling cleans by day/time
- Switching between S-path, spot, and edge cleaning
- Checking cleaning progress and battery status
- Remote start/stop and retuning to dock
Voice controls let users say, “Alexa, start cleaning” for easier hands-free operation, a rare perk in this price bracket.

How PUCRC455 Stands Up to Popular Competitors
Feature | PUCRC455 | Eufy RoboVac 11S | ILIFE V3s Pro |
---|---|---|---|
Mapping | Gyroscope (S-path) | Random | Random |
Max Suction | 1100Pa | 1300Pa | 1000Pa |
Battery Runtime | 110 min | 100 min | 90–100 min |
Height | 2.9” | 2.85” | 2.98” |
Voice Control | Alexa/Google | No | No |
App Control | Yes (Smart Life) | No | No |
MSRP Range (est.) | Mid | Mid | Budget |
While it can’t match the raw suction of the Eufy, the PUCRC455 brings superior mapping and smart home features compared to many traditional budget robots.

Frequently Asked Questions About the PUCRC455
Does the PUCRC455 work with thick carpets?
It performs best on hardwood, tile, and low-pile carpets. Thick, plush carpets may reduce suction and navigation ability.
Can I control the vacuum away from home?
Yes, the Smart Life app supports scheduling, monitoring, and manual start/stop from anywhere with Internet access.
How often do I need to empty the dustbin?
Most households empty the 0.6-liter bin after 1–2 cleaning sessions, depending on floor type and pet hair.
Is voice control setup difficult?
Some users report initial confusion with the app or Alexa pairing, but step-by-step setup is included, and customer service can help if you encounter issues.
Does it support room-by-room mapping?
No, it uses gyroscopic S-path cleaning, not advanced LiDAR or camera-based mapping. It won’t create precise room boundaries.
